Historical Background and Strategic Growth
Formed in 1997 through the merger of Grand Metropolitan and Guinness, Diageo was born from a legacy of brand excellence and international reach. This significant union set the stage for future mergers and bolt-on acquisitions that have enhanced its product and market portfolio. The acquisition of key assets from Seagram in 2001 further broadened its offerings with globally recognized brands such as Captain Morgan rum and Crown Royal Canadian whisky. Diageo’s strategic decisions, which include divesting noncore assets over time, underscore a business model focused on sustainable excellence and portfolio optimization.
Global Operations and Market Footprint
Headquartered in London, Diageo operates from over a hundred sites across the world, reflecting a robust and diversified global presence. Its products are sold in well over 180 countries, making the company not only a major player in the premium spirits market but also a benchmark for operational excellence in global supply chain management and international distribution. Product Portfolio and Business Model
At its core, Diageo is a manufacturer and marketer of premium spirits, beers, and wines. Its portfolio includes iconic labels such as Johnnie Walker, Guinness, Crown Royal, and Captain Morgan, among others. Smirnoff is expanding its Spicy Tamarind flavor to over 15 new markets in the United States, featuring a vibrant Día De Muertos-inspired design. This sweet and spicy vodka, with 35% ABV, combines tamarind with Mexican chilies and lime, retailing at $12.99 for a 750ml bottle. The launch is supported by digital ads and a partnership with chefs for recipe pairings available on Smirnoff.com. This permanent offering in select states and limited-time availability elsewhere aims to cater to the growing consumer interest in unique flavors.
Captain Morgan launched its new product, Sliced Apple Spiced Rum, on October 20, 2020. This flavored rum is designed to be enjoyed straight or as shots. To celebrate its release, Captain Morgan collaborated with 11 artists across 10 cities to create murals reflecting local cultures. The campaign emphasizes community support and engagement through creative partnerships. Additionally, a competition among content creators will showcase promotional content for the new rum, focusing on engagement. The product is available in the U.S. and Canada for a suggested retail price of $15.99.
On October 15, 2020, Guinness announced the Guinness Gives Back limited-edition pack, contributing $1 per pack sold to community charities across the U.S., aimed at supporting Covid-19 relief and combating food insecurity. This initiative includes regional packs for New York, California, Chicago, and Boston, along with a national version benefitting Direct Relief. Guinness recently committed $2 million to related relief efforts, reinforcing its dedication to American communities during challenging times.
Baileys reintroduces Baileys Red Velvet in honor of National Dessert Day, collaborating with Georgetown Cupcake founders. Last year's launch won Double Gold at the San Francisco Spirits Competition. This limited-edition flavor is available for a suggested retail price of $24.99 for a 750ml bottle. The flavor captures the essence of red velvet cupcakes with cream cheese frosting. To celebrate, Georgetown Cupcake offers Baileys Red Velvet Dozen cupcakes. Baileys aims to bring joy and indulgence during the holidays through this flavorful treat.
Diageo announces the launch of the Cascade Moon Whisky series, celebrating 150 years of heritage with innovative offerings. The first release, Cascade Moon Edition No. 1, features an 11-year-old whisky with unique flavor notes reminiscent of a gose-style beer. Priced at $89.99, it will be available in Tennessee, California, and Texas starting this fall. This new line aims to showcase the distillery's depth beyond the traditional Tennessee whisky category and offers consumers an intriguing tasting experience that respects both tradition and modernity.

More than 90% of independent venues in the U.S. face permanent closure due to COVID-19. In response, Crown Royal is launching a relief campaign in partnership with Main Street Alliance to support these cultural landmarks, which employ approximately 15.6 million people. The initiative includes a new version of the song "If You Want Me to Stay," featuring artists Ari Lennox and Anthony Ramos, where funds will be donated for every stream. This effort aims to help affected venues survive while promoting community support through music.
